When I lived in Chicago, my daily driver (circa 1980) was a 389 Tri-Power '66 Goat. It ran fantastic, except on rainy or high humidity days when the temp was in the mid 30s to low 40s. The center carb would ice up on the throttle base for a brief minute before it was fully warmed up. You could pop the hood & touch the throttle plate on the center carb, & it would be ice cold even though the rest of the engine felt hot. Of course the 3 open element air cleaners were not designed to help that condition.
